Join Us for the Premiere of a Powerful New Conservation Film
Experience the world premiere screening of The Real Yellowstone — a groundbreaking documentary that challenges mainstream narratives and explores the real future of the American West.
Told through the voices of multigenerational ranchers, outfitters, and conservationists, this film reveals the complex relationship between rural families, public land, and the wildlife that surrounds them.
This isn’t about parks or postcards. It’s about people. It’s about survival.
